Here’s the first recipe I wanted to share. You can find this recipe on WhoNu?’s website, too (along with many others).
- ½ cup sugar
- ⅓ cup whole-wheat flour
- 2 eggs
- 2 cups milk
- ¼ tsp salt
- ½ tsp vanilla
- ½ tsp cinnamon
- 24 WhoNu?® Vanilla Wafer Cookies
- 2 large bananas, sliced
- In a medium saucepan, add sugar, flour, eggs, milk and salt. Stir well with a whisk.
- Cook the mixture over medium-low heat, stirring constantly, until it starts to thicken (about 15 minutes).
- Remove the saucepan from heat and stir in the vanilla and cinnamon. Set aside.
- Place 1 WhoNu?® Vanilla Wafer Cookie on the bottom of each of 12 paper-lined muffin cups. (We recommend buying the cups that are lined with foil.)
- Place 3 banana slices on top of the cookie.
- Pour pudding over the cookie and bananas, filling each muffin liner about ¾ full.
- Banana puddings can be eaten hot, or chilled and eaten cold later. Yummy topped with whipped cream!
